... > Curiosity > Sols > 571 > ←Prev / Next→

Curiosity Left Navcam

Sol 571 12:50 Site 30/0000 NLB_448184831EDR_D0300000SSS_15831M_
Mar 15, 2014 at 7:46:08 PM UTC (approximate)
Credit: NASA / JPL-Caltech

Image Source

View in App